Encyclopedia > Crisis (film)

Young Nelly lives a quiet life with her foster mother until her real mother makes an appearance. Attracted by the fancy dresses and daring adult life in Stockholm offered by her real mother, Nelly leaves the small town and discovers the darker sides of human nature...
